It was an animal similar to a reptile, but in reality it belonged to the group of therapsids, a precursor lineage of mammals. It had a stocky body and short legs, suggesting that it spent most of its time on dry land. Its skull had characteristics adapted for a herbivorous diet, indicating that it fed on plants and vegetation.
